Reading comprehension capitalization is crucial for children ages 4-8 because it lays the foundation for essential literacy skills and effective communication. At this early developmental stage, children are in the process of learning how to read and write. Understanding the importance of capitalization aids in developing their overall comprehension and language skills.
Firstly, correct capitalization helps young readers to better understand the structure of sentences. For instance, recognizing that sentences begin with a capital letter allows children to distinguish where one thought ends and another begins, which is essential for understanding text cohesively. Moreover, proper nouns—people’s names, places, days of the week—begin with capital letters which help children identify and properly use significant words within their readings.
For teachers and parents, emphasizing capitalization also encourages attention to detail and fosters good writing habits early on. Teaching children the rules of capitalization boosts their confidence as readers and writers and plays a vital role in their academic success. Lastly, recognizing and using capitalization correctly ensures clear communication, preventing misunderstandings that can arise from incorrect writing.
Focusing on reading comprehension capitalization for children ages 4-8 is indispensable as it promotes literacy, enhances understanding, and encourages precision in both reading and writing, forming the bedrock for effective learning and communication later in life.
